An Argentine from the time of the partnership between Corinthians and MSI wants to return to the São Jorge Park team. It's not the Mascherano steering wheel, holder of Barcelona, nor Carlitos Tevez, star of Juventus. The one who misses Alvinegro is the quarterback Sebastián Dominguez, the Sebá.
‘Sure, I'd like to come back, always. I've been here five years at Vélez, I'm fine, but today, playing in the Corinthians... For me it is one of the best teams in America’, said the defender after facing the Black Bridge with Vélez Sarsfield, on Thursday, for the South American Cup.
Sebá did not leave such good impressions on Corinthians, although he was a Brazilian champion in 2005. In Argentina, however, he has quite a prestige, having won four Argentine championships with Vélez.
Although distant from Brazil, the former Corinthian continued to follow national football. For him, by the way, the Brazilian Championship is far ahead of the Argentinean.
‘The team is fine, in Argentina we talk. Institutionally even. I'm watching the games in Brazil, and after Europe, Brazilian football is almost the same. For us Argentines it is beautiful to watch the games and for us it is also a very big difference. The fields, the teams, the players who came back. The Corinthians, even with all the figures that came back, was world champion. ’
Sebá also maintained from Brazil the affection for Corinthians. ‘When he was world champion he was here in Brazil and watched the game. All the Corinthians have gone crazy! I'm glad Corinthians is okay. I left a lot of friends. ’
